Simply click the snag-it button below and either copy the widget directly to your preferred social network site or blog or copy the embed tag and paste it on your website. What is a Widget? Accoring to Wikipedia: A Web Widget is a portable chunk of code that can be installed and executed within any separate HTML-based web page by an end user without requiring additional compilation. Web Widgets can be utilized by end users to enhance a number of web-based hosts, or drop targets. Categories of drop targets include social networks, blogs, personal homepages, and operating system desktops.
